Population Services International (PSI) is the world's leading non-profit social marketing organization, with a mission to measurably improve the health of poor and vulnerable people in the developing world by influencing their behavior, principally through social marketing of family planning and health products and services, and health communications. PSI has programs in more than 60 countries and works in malaria, HIV, reproductive health, child survival, and tuberculosis. PSI's core values are a belief in markets and market mechanisms to contribute to sustained improvements in the lives of the poor; results and a strong focus on measurement; speed and efficiency with a predisposition to action and an aversion to bureaucracy; decentralization and empowering our staff at the local level; and a long term commitment to the people we serve. PSI seeks applicants for the position of New Business Development Manager to help direct PSI's activities in developing new business worldwide with bilateral and multilateral donors.  The New Business Development Manager will be based in Washington, D.C., with approximately 20-30% overseas travel, and report to the Director of Business Development.  

RESPONSIBILITIES:   
The New Business Development Manager is a demanding, challenging and exciting role, requiring a dynamic individual with highly developed communication skills and an excellent sense of humor.  PSI's NBD Department offers assistance to field-based programs when responding to the US government, the private sector, and other donor requests for proposals.  In 2009 and 2010, NBD will take an increasing role in assisting "needy" countries or health areas, and will also work to train field staff in how to prepare proposals.  Specific responsibilities include but are not limited to:
  • Managing all aspects of proposal development by working with field and headquarters staff on program design, proposal writing and (on occasion) cost proposal development
  • Traveling to provide technical assistance to the field programs as needed for proposal development/capacity building
  • Coordinating efforts between PSI and partner organizations on specific proposals
  • Directing the development and maintenance of information required for responding to proposals, including maintaining and updating capability statements, descriptions of technical areas of competence/focus, project write-ups, PPRs, management and mobilization plans, graphics, etc
  • Expanding the capabilities of PSI staff to participate in technical and cost proposals and other business development efforts through mentoring and direct training
  • Collaborating with senior management to identify and strategize on new business opportunities
  • Managing relationships for a portfolio of private donors (which may include proposal writing, report writing, ongoing communications and meetings, etc.)
  • Researching and writing briefs for PSI staff on issues related to New Business Development (e.g. donor and partner organization profiles)
  • Contributing to the continuous improvement of PSI's systems for identifying, tracking, and pursuing new business opportunities, developing proposals and budgets, and managing institutional knowledge

QUALIFICATIONS: 
  • Relevant Master's degree (MBA, MPA, MPH, etc)
  • 5+ years of experience related to international development (international health preferred)
  • 3 years of demonstrated NBD experience
  • Excellent diplomatic, negotiating and interpersonal communication capability
  • Outstanding English writing skills
  • Developing country work experience and foreign language skills (esp. Spanish or French) strongly preferred.
The position requires the ability to work gracefully under pressure and support our new business development efforts in collaboration with PSI managers and partner organizations.  The ideal candidate will possess a professional demeanor, sound judgment, and commitment to international development.  The ideal candidate will also exhibit the ability to work independently, with superior organizational skills and attention to detail.  Travel may be necessary.
